The table below shows the financial compensation corresponding to different types of accidents and injuries. This Schedule applies to both Total School and Individual Cover.

Note that Double Benefits represents twice the compensation of Standard across all incident types.

*Broken or Fractured Bones due to an Accident

These benefits will reduce to 50% if Sports-related. Sports-related means:
a)     School sports, or
b)   Sports where the insured person is participating in or training for an organised competition which is under the control of an Association.
